The Rapido Trains N Scale Budd RDC-1 is based on rail diesel carsintroduced in the late 1940s for operation on routes that could not justifylocomotive-hauled trains. The 85ft long self-propelled coaches, which werepowered by a pair of Detroit Diesel Series 110 engines, could be employedin single formation or coupled together with other examples - allcontrolled from In the United States, the Boston & Maine was the principaluser of these single-car units, but they were also an important part of therural lines and short-haul commuter passenger fleet of other railroadcompanies, including the Santa Fe, B&O, New Haven, NP, NYC, Reading, SP,and many others. Many later went on to Amtrak and various commuter agenciessuch as the Metro-North among others. RDCs can still be found in smallnumbers on scenic lines in both countries, as well as some In Canada, CNand CP rostered large numbers of RDCs, which later passed to VIA. The RDCserved branchlines from coast to coast and were a means of reducing thecosts of unprofitable local runs. They were also ubiquitous on themainline, often in multiple units of three, six or even 11 cars! CN's RDCscould be found across the country in early years and mainly in the Torontoarea in later years. Eager to cut costs, CP used the RDCs everywhere,especially in commuter service, the Maritimes, and on Vancouver Island. InVIA years, the RDC formed the backbone of shorter services in Quebec, theToronto area and the Maritimes, as well as in Alberta and BC.
